&lt;div class="asl-wikipage-summary"&gt;The cover is critical to a book&amp;#39;s success, because it can be what motivates someone to pick up the book at all. Whether you hire a freelance designer, or have your publisher design the cover, it&amp;#39;s important that you&amp;#39;re involved in the process. Author Cindy Jones describes how her cover came to be, and in the telling, you&amp;#39;ll hear the important things you should consider when working with a designer, such as having input and options.&lt;/div&gt;
